Router A, Router B and Router C that belong to the same autonomous system
and the same OSPF routing domain are GR capable.
Router A acts as the non IETF standard GR Restarter, and Router B and Router
C are the GR Helpers and remain OOB synchronized with Router A through the
GR mechanism.
